Job Summary

The Research Data Analyst will work under the direction of the Principal Investigator (PI) to assist graduate students, postdoctoral fellows, clinical fellows, and other team members with research projects, with a primary focus on data analysis, statistical modeling, and computational analysis. Depending on project needs, the Research Data Analyst may also participate in clinical research, animal experiments, and related laboratory research activities.

Essential Functions
-Provide direct assistance with experimental studies.

-Performs basic computational modeling and statistical analysis; prepares drafts of work for review; applies feedback received to create final analyses and/or reports.

-Meets with the PI and team to discuss work plans, activities, and results to support the applicability of efforts, learning opportunities, and professional development.

-Reviews, collates, and prepares standard analyses of medical record data.

-Perform administrative tasks, such as required for data collection; prepare documentation and record-keeping; update databases; run reports.

-Conducts literature searches and submits appropriate articles to PI and team for consideration; identifies topics of interest for personal reading and may present at lab meetings.
